Abrar ul Haq to fulfill Ali Sadpara's dream of building school
Karachi: Acclaimed Pakistani singer and philanthropist Abrar-ul-Haq pledged that he will build a school in missing Pakistani mountaineer, Ali Sadpara’s village to honor his dream.

Abrar turned to his official handle and stated that he will honor Sadpara by building a school in his village which was his aim after accomplishing the K2 Winter ascent.
“I have just heard the news that Muhammad Ali Sadpara wanted to build a school in his village after his mission,” he wrote.
He further added, “Therefore we have decided to fulfill his dream and Inshahallah a school will be built in the village of our hero in his memory”.
